139 succumb to COVID-19 in 24 hours, a single day high death toll



KATHMANDU: With 139 more people succumbing to coronavirus in 24 hours, Nepal has seen the highest ever death toll from the pandemic.

According to the Ministry of Health and Population, as many as 139 persons succumbed to the virus in the last 24 hours in the country.

So far, the total number of recorded deaths due to coronavirus in the country has reached 3,859.
